Can 2011 Land Rover LR2 rotors be resurfaced or do they need to be replaced?

Resurface only if the rotor remains above the minimum thickness stamped on the part; if below spec, replacement is required.

Many modern rotors, including those on a 2011 Land Rover LR2, have limited surplus material and may reach or approach the 22MIN TH22 after the first wear cycle. Well mic and document front and rear rotors, check runout, and advise if machining is safe. If replacement is needed, we install Genuine Land Rover rotors and road test for smooth braking.

Do I need to replace rotors when I replace pads on a 2011 Land Rover LR2?

Not always; rotors only require replacement if below the stamped minimum thickness or visibly damaged.

During a 2011 Land Rover LR2 brake service, our technicians measure rotor thickness, inspect for grooves and heat spots, and evaluate runout. If the rotors meet spec and have an even surface, new pads can bed-in properly without replacement. What are the signs of bad rotors on a 2011 Land Rover LR2?

Common signs include brake pulsation, visible scoring or grooves, blue heat marks, or thickness below the stamped minimum.

If your 2011 Land Rover LR2 shudders under braking or shows uneven pad transfers, its time for an inspection. Bostons urban driving and winter de-icing materials can accelerate rotor corrosion, especially at the hub-to-rotor interface. Why are my 2011 Land Rover LR2 rotors warping?

Most 22warp22 feels like thickness variation or uneven pad deposits rather than a rotor bending.

Repeated hot stops in city driving or holding the brake after a hard stop can imprint pad material onto a 2011 Land Rover LR2 rotor face. Over time, this creates a high/low spot you feel as pulsation. We correct this by measuring thickness, checking runout, and replacing rotors when theyre below spec. Whats the difference between rotor and pad issues on a 2011 Land Rover LR2 in Boston?

Pulsation under light-to-moderate braking points to rotor thickness variation, while squeal often indicates pad glazing or wear indicators.

On a 2011 Land Rover LR2, rotors with runout or uneven deposits create a rhythmic vibration; worn pads more commonly squeal or trigger a warning lamp. Whats Included in a 2011 Land Rover LR2 Rotor Replacement

Every 2011 Land Rover LR2 rotor job starts with documented micrometer readings to confirm serviceability. If replacement is needed, we remove the caliper and rotor, clean the hub face to bare metal, and install Genuine Land Rover rotors matched to your VIN. New hardware is fitted where required, pad thickness and condition are verified, and brake fluid level is checked. We then follow a controlled bedding-in procedure and perform a road test to confirm smooth, linear stopping with no vibration.
